If thumbnails are lagging on Pexbin uploads, first check the Thumbler queue depth dashboard. Anything over 50k pending jobs means the workers are starved — usually because someone uploaded a giant batch of TIFFs again. Scale the worker pool to 12 before doing anything fancier. If jobs are failing rather than queuing, look for poison messages; the dead-letter bin fills fast and the retry loop will chew CPU. Drain it, requeue, and watch for ten minutes. The worker pool currently runs with the configuration below.

service settings:
[ulair]
team = praath
access_code = ac_06d704
owner = wenix.ulair
host = ulair.qirvancorp.corp
port = 9200
peer = sorys.nelvronet.internal
salt = 2668132c
pin = 9140

## Deployment

Before deploying Luminoak's contrast-audit service, verify that every build passes the color-contrast accessibility audit stage. The pipeline checks all rendered components against WCAG-style ratios and fails the release if any pairing falls below threshold. New team members should run the audit locally first, since fixing contrast regressions after deploy requires a full repaint cycle. Once the audit passes, deploy with the standard Fennelwick toolchain. The service reads the following configuration at startup.

service settings:
WENATH_PIN=5007
WENATH_METRICS_HOST=metrics.wenath.tolvaqlabs.corp
WENATH_LOG_LEVEL=debug
WENATH_TENANT=rusox

Leadership Review Briefing — Eastern Region Sales

Heads of department: the eastern region closed the quarter 7% below target. Pipeline coverage is thin in the Vorley and Astenmere territories, and two senior reps departed mid-quarter. Mitigations: accelerated hiring, reassignment of key accounts, and a focused push on the Credon renewal base. Western and central regions remain on plan. Forecast confidence for next quarter is moderate. The strategic response is summarised in the note below.

board note of baweg-bawig: Project Tamath slips by six weeks because of the audit delay.